Output e29bd708834827a58f17f4c7113b0e2dbe3446a620c57118f20f9e5a77e30d7c:1

value
80653549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47ee0e9fbceeeb960710f1edf221627a08cdeb3b OP_EQUALVERIFY OP_CHECKSIG
address
17ZLA7uE38sDXwS9xzboeahY2uY7BTj7p7
transaction
e29bd708834827a58f17f4c7113b0e2dbe3446a620c57118f20f9e5a77e30d7c
spent
true